The Great Salt Lake: A Story of Water, Life, and Challenges
TL;DR: The Great Salt Lake is a vital part of Utah’s ecosystem, but it’s shrinking due to drought and overuse. This is bad news for the lake, wildlife, and humans. We need to save water, use it wisely, and work together to keep the Great Salt Lake healthy!
A Giant Thirsty Sponge: The Great Salt Lake’s Water Cycle
Imagine the Great Salt Lake as a giant sponge that soaks up water from the sky and the surrounding mountains. This water comes from rain, snow, and melting glaciers. It flows down rivers and streams, like the Jordan River, and fills the lake. The water stays in the lake for a while, but it doesn’t just sit there. The sun heats the lake, turning some of the water into vapor that rises into the air. This process is called evaporation. The lake also loses water when it seeps into the ground or flows out through underground channels.
The Water Crisis: When the Sponge Gets Too Dry
The Great Salt Lake is facing a serious water crisis. Think of the sponge getting squeezed dry. Here’s what’s happening:
- Drought: The area around the Great Salt Lake is experiencing longer and more intense droughts, meaning less rain and snowfall. This means the lake receives less water.
- Overuse: Humans are using more water than ever before for drinking, farming, and industry. This leaves less water to flow into the Great Salt Lake.
- Climate Change: Climate change is making the weather more extreme, leading to both more droughts and more floods. These extremes make it harder for the lake to stay healthy.
The Impact: A Ripple Effect
The shrinking Great Salt Lake is a big problem for the whole region. Here’s why:
- Wildlife: Many birds, fish, and other animals rely on the Great Salt Lake for food, water, and shelter. As the lake shrinks, their habitats disappear, and their populations decline.
- Air Quality: The lake’s salty water helps keep the air clean by trapping dust and other pollutants. But as the lake shrinks, the air gets dirtier, making it harder to breathe for everyone.
- Economy: The Great Salt Lake supports a thriving tourism industry and provides important resources for businesses. As the lake shrinks, these businesses suffer, and the economy weakens.
Solutions: Saving the Sponge
There are many things we can do to help save the Great Salt Lake:
- Water Conservation: We can all do our part by using less water at home, at work, and in our communities. This includes taking shorter showers, fixing leaky faucets, and watering our lawns less often.
- Innovative Irrigation: Farmers can use water more efficiently by using new irrigation techniques that deliver water directly to the roots of plants, reducing waste.
- Policy Measures: Governments can pass laws and regulations that encourage water conservation and protect the Great Salt Lake. This could include setting limits on water use, investing in water-saving technologies, and restoring wetlands that help filter water.
